Skuleberget is perhaps the High Coast's most iconic landmark and here you will find the world's highest coastline, 286 meters above sea level.

At the foot of the mighty Skuleberget is naturum Höga Kusten. Here you will find exciting exhibitions about land uplift and the fantastic geology of the High Coast. There is also a play area for children and a restaurant. Just a stone's throw away is Naturscen Skuleberget, an outdoor stage where many famous artists perform every year. Right next to naturum Höga Kusten you will find Docksta shoe factory where handmade Swedish shoes have been made for almost 100 years. Visit the shop and buy your own loafers.

If you feel like hiking, there are plenty of places to discover around Skuleberget and Docksta. From the top of Skuleberget you are offered a magnificent view of the World Heritage Site. For the adventurous, we recommend climbing in Europe's largest Via Ferrata facility. Or take the cable car up to the summit cabin where you can enjoy good food combined with fantastic views of the World Heritage Site. A bit from Skuleberget you will find Getsvedjeberget. From Veåsand and Skulebergets Havscamping sea campsite there is a marked trail up to the top and the overhang called "Predikstolen". Here you have a fantastic view of Norrfjärden and can sit and dangle your legs over the edge.
